Have A Plan

People who know what they are going to eat lose more weight. This happens because they set themselves up for success by having a plan of action. By having a clear idea of what you are going to eat through the week, you avoid overeating. Instead of skipping meals and mindlessly snacking on whatever is available, prepare healthy and nutritious meals that are designed to keep you feeling full. And if you do get the urge to snack, plan ahead and have low calorie snacks to keep you satisfied.

Skip The Sugar

Sugar is one of the biggest culprits when it comes to gaining weight. This sweet substance is put into many of the foods we eat. Processed foods, like TV dinners, along with fruit juices are laden with sugar, even though they may advertise that they are good for you. Don’t be fooled! Many fruit juices have nearly as much sugar as a can of soda! The best way to avoid this pitfall is to read the nutrition labels on the products you buy. Check out the amount of sugar and stay away from any item that has more than 15 grams of sugar per serving.

Get Out Of That Chair

Most of us have sedentary jobs that include sitting in a chair for hours on end. This is a diet killer that will lead you down the road to obesity in a hurry. There is an easy way to incorporate exercise into your routine and help you lose weight. Getting up and standing for five minutes at a time, two or three times an hour will help you to build muscle and burn calories right at your desk. It is also important to get up and walk around a couple times a day to get the heart pumping and the blood flowing. So grab your smart phone and set up an alarm that will remind you to get out of that chair and get moving.
